On 3/15/2016 8:36 AM, Gerrit Haase wrote:
> Back then there was some postinstallation script which was creating
> basic files like /etc/profile and other basic things were created with
> the first login, like/home/<user> directory, including basic files
> there.

That's still the case.  The relevant postinstall script is 
/etc/postinstall/base-files-profile.sh.  You might check 
/var/log/setup.log and/or /var/log/setup.log.full to see if you can tell 
why it failed.  Or try running it manually.
